MBENZ Technicial Sprayed WD40 on Pulley and Belt
There was a little squealing noise, I could live with it, then the MBENZ guy sprayed WD40 on both the pulley and belts. Got rid of one noice, then this really bad, rubbling, grinding noise appeared from the big belt (sorry guys I have no idea about cars). Any ideas what he done?

Bad idea! WD 40 will dry out the belts and eventually weaken it.

I would demand that the service department replace your belts. I've never seen a tech use any techniques outside of protocol (while in the shop). That is really strange that he would. Typically, if you complain about squeeling, they will sell you a new belt not try to get an extra 1000 miles out of the one you have.
